Chapter 48 Visiting the Cui Residence
The experts sent by the Sixth Prince arrived quickly; they were all his close bodyguards. Gu Linglong arrived shortly after finishing her milk.
Su Xiuran selected several guards from her household and those brought by the Sixth Prince to go to the Cui residence.
At this moment, the gates of the Cui residence were tightly closed. Douzhu knocked several times before they were slowly opened.
She frowned, somewhat worried. Her young mistress was always very kind to their maids: "Madam, it seems something has truly happened to my young mistress."
Su Xiuran's face turned ashen.
The door slowly opened, and the butler bowed respectfully, saying, "Madam Gu, please return. Our young mistress has caught a cold today and is not receiving guests."
Su Xiuran: "Then I'll go visit her in the hospital."
The butler blocked their way with both hands: "The young mistress said she doesn't receive guests. Madam Gu, please don't make things difficult for us servants."
I won't make things difficult for you; just move aside.
The butler remained unmoved and tried to close the door, but Su Xiuran blocked it with her hand, her tone becoming sharp: "Get out of the way, or the guards behind me won't be trifled with."
So fierce!
The butler was intimidated by Su Xiuran's imposing manner. He had heard that Madam Gu was dignified, gentle, and kind, which was why he dared to close the door to the First-Rank Imperial Lady.
Unexpectedly, they were so powerful. The steward glanced at the guards behind Su Xiuran. They were all burly and strong. If this punch landed, they would probably knock out a few teeth.
The butler shuddered and carefully stepped aside.
Su Xiuran then withdrew her hand and led the group menacingly towards Gu Xinyi's courtyard.
Seeing that something was wrong, Xiao Si immediately sent a message to Madam Cui.
As soon as she entered the courtyard, she was stopped by two maids. The maids bowed to Madam Gu, but their attitude was arrogant: "Madam Gu, please leave. Our young mistress is recuperating and does not receive guests."
Su Xiuran: "I'll go take a look."
The old woman stepped forward: "Madam Gu, please go back. If the illness is passed on to you, we servants cannot afford to compensate you."
"Whatever, I'll go take a look."
Please don't make things difficult for our servants.
Su Xiuran's brow twitched violently. These unruly servants had been blocking her way. Could it be that her sister-in-law was already in grave danger?
She didn't want to waste any more words with these unruly servants and prepared to force her way in, but another nanny spread her arms to block Su Xiuran.
"This old servant must remind you, Madam, that this is the Cui residence, not the Gu residence. You are not permitted to barge in. Moreover, the presence of so many men outside the family is detrimental to the reputation of our young mistress. Therefore, this old servant has no way of letting you in."
Su Xiuran clenched her fists: "Then can I go in with my maid?"
The old woman replied arrogantly, "No, the young mistress said she won't see any guests, and that's final. Madam Gu, please leave."
"Ha, then I'll have no choice but to force my way in. Take down these two unruly servants, and Nüjun, come with me."
"You dare! Even if you are a first-rank imperial consort, you cannot act arrogantly towards the servants of the Cui household!"
Looking at the two nannies' smug expressions, Su Xiuran wondered how they might bully her sister-in-law in private.
"So what if I act like a tyrant?"
"Disrespectful to a first-rank noblewoman, slap her!"
"Wait a minute"
A slightly aged voice rang out: "Madam Gu, what arrogance you have! Coming to my residence to slap my servants! Even if the two matrons were negligent, it should be my responsibility to punish them, not yours to overstep your bounds."
Su Xiuran turned to look at the person who had come in. It was Cui Sheng's mother, Old Madam Cui. She was somewhat thin, with a broad forehead and high cheekbones. She was wearing a dark red plain brocade robe, and her neck, wrists, and ears were all glittering with gold.
Most elderly women love jade, but Old Mrs. Cui was adorned with gold from head to toe, looking incredibly wealthy and greasy. She walked slowly with the help of her maid.
Looking at Madam Cui's attire, Su Xiuran felt inexplicably displeased. Her sister-in-law was dressed plainly, while her mother-in-law was adorned with gold and silver. Could all of her jewelry be with Madam Cui?
Su Xiuran suppressed her suspicions and politely addressed Old Madam Cui.
Gu Linglong looked up at Old Madam Cui and clicked her tongue when she saw a faint gray, decaying aura surrounding her head.
[Tsk~, this person has a flat, thin forehead and prominent cheekbones. He was a philanderer when he was young, but he'll be a jinx to his children when he gets old.]
Hearing her daughter's heartfelt words, Su Xiuran glanced at Old Madam Cui again. No wonder Old Master Cui passed away at such a young age.
Indeed, he's a jinx to his husband!
Old Madam Cui noticed Su Xiuran scrutinizing her and seemed displeased: "Madam Gu, please leave. My daughter-in-law is not receiving guests."
Su Xiuran: "I must see my sister-in-law today. I would appreciate it if Madam Cui could do me this favor."
"Humph"
Madam Cui slammed her cane hard against the ground with a loud bang.
"I can't do that, are you just going to force your way in?"
Su Xiuran did not deny it: "There is no reason in the world to prevent a daughter-in-law from seeing her family. You say my sister is sick, but you have to let me see her, right? Otherwise, it's just empty talk. How will anyone know where you've hidden my sister?"
Looking at Su Xiuran's witty remarks, Old Madam Cui felt a sense of integrity. How come she had never noticed that Su Xiuran was so good at talking before?
"No way! I'm her mother-in-law. I said she's recuperating, and that's it. I said I won't see her, and that's it. If you keep making trouble, don't blame the Cui family for not providing adequate hospitality."
Upon hearing this, the guards on both sides simultaneously unsheathed their swords.
Gu Xinyi, who was lying in the room in the courtyard, was excited when she heard Su Xiuran's voice.
She propped herself up and sat up; her sister-in-law had come to pick her up.
As soon as she got out of bed, a wave of dizziness hit her, and she retreated back to the bedside.
Lotus, who was pouring water, rushed over to help Gu Xinyi: "Madam, slow down."
Gu Xinyi, using the lotus flower's hand for support, stood up again: "My sister-in-law has come to pick me up, I want to go out."
“But…” Lotus hesitated, unable to finish her sentence.
"what happened?"
"The old woman at the gate hasn't left since last night; we can't get out like this."
Gu Xinyi sat back down dejectedly; Cui Shengzhen had really gone too far.
After a while, she heard Old Madam Cui's voice again, and she became extremely anxious.
She knew best how tormenting her mother-in-law was, and knew that her sister-in-law, being such a dignified and generous person, would definitely suffer.
No, she has to go out.
As soon as she opened the door, two old women blocked her way: "Madam, please go back. You cannot leave this room without the master's permission."
Looking at the two plump and strong old women at the door, he clicked his tongue, realizing that he wouldn't be able to force his way out.
She took out a silver ingot and placed it in the old woman's hand: "Please do me a favor, old woman, I just need to go out to see my sister-in-law."
One of the old women's eyes flashed with a shrewd light as she put the silver into her bosom.
"Thank you, Madam. I will definitely send someone to tell your sister-in-law that you are well and that she can rest assured."
Gu Xinyi panicked: "Granny, that's not what I meant. I meant I want to go out."
"Then I'm sorry, Madam, we dare not disobey the Master's orders."
Gu Xinyi was already poor, and the nanny was taking her money but not doing anything, which made her so angry that she felt dizzy.
Lotus quickly helped her up, angrily shouting, "Then give the money back! Give it back!"
"This servant doesn't know what Miss Lotus is talking about, please go back."
As she spoke, she stepped forward and pushed the lotus flower, almost causing Gu Xinyi to fall as well.
"Bang!" The old woman slammed the door shut.
It seemed that pleading with them was pointless, so Lotus pounded on the door, yelling, "Open the door! Open the door!"
The old woman remained unmoved, so Lotus began to scold: "Our lady has always treated you well, is this how you repay her?"
"A pack of heartless, barking wolves"
